He's not wrong. I have my "waking" and "sleeping" routines written out separately from anything else I need to do. After 7 months the sleeping is basically every day now without the list, and I'm now trying to get the waking routine the same. Doing it all daily when I'd barely done anything before was too much. Then I have a weekly checklist with 4-5 dots beside the tasks (washing the cats fountain, or taking the bins to the curb, for example). I have a spread every month in my journal that has calendars and all of my daily habits/tasks written 1 per calendar. I go over that about mid-way through the day to see what I've forgotten to do, and check it again at the end of the day when I still have time to do any I think can't wait. Other non-daily/non-regular tasks are on a "To-Do" for the whole week, and usually come from a monthly selection of things I think I'll want or need to do at some point that month. By pulling from a master list I get the dopamine fix of checking them off in multiple spots. 😉 If I still tried to do everything in 1 big daily list that I had to write every day I'd get completely overwhelmed and do 2 or 3 items out of everything, task list or daily, and shut down mentally/hyper-focus on electronics. By picking and choosing from the weekly task I also don't feel so pressured to get everything done if my mental capabilities aren't there that day.

i'm a gamer, so i organize my lists like quests haha! i have my dailies list up where i can easily see it (showering, eating, exercise, etc), and then i make a list of weekly quests each sunday - things like work, appts, cleaning. each day i aim to finish my dailies (though i rarely get the whole list done on any given day 😂), and then pick a few things from my weekly list, depending on my "mana" level for the day. i have found that this method makes it a little less stressful (yay demand avoidance!) because i can assess how much energy i have each day and shuffle tasks around throughout the week as needed! it's also helping me to be more present and mindful of my needs and abilities, and helping me to find grace and patience with myself in the process!

Yeah. I have a list of "always" to do and it is written on a piece of paper that is one of those plastic paper protector things that go in binders. (It's a 5x7 because I don't like lists on big paper). Anyway, I then can add whatever I want on the plastic part and also check things off my always list - like dry erase - but I use fine line permanent marker instead and then use a little hanky with some rubbing alcohol when I need to clear things. This way, if my permanent list needs changing it is just a piece of paper and I can keep track. I also have a sheet protector on a normal size that is broken up in 5 sections for the work week and that is my "what did you do today?" sheet and I can write whatever I want which can be big or small accomplishments or meetings that I know I have/had. Planners just seem to not work. 1 single piece of paper in a sheet protector is way easier to manage and if I do somehow lose it, it is very easy to replicate and I don't feel as bad.

I used to have a to-do list but ended up losing it, no matter the form. I now have systems rather than lists. I have a good day -- the bare minimum: I wake up, the cats get insulin, I may or may not stay awake. It's a 'good' day because I'm trying to remove all the negative words I can. I have a better day -- all the good day stuff plus I do work (there are other schedules and lists for work, too tedious to outline although my brain is saying DO IT DO IT DO IT). And I have a best day. Those are the days where good and better are finished early and I can let myself do as I please, either a traditional list of things to work through. or better yet -- a side quest day. I give myself permission to just follow my ADHD brain where it leads me with the only caveat being I can't leave more mess than I started with. If my next day is a good day, then all that leftover mess from the best day just causes havoc. It's been working pretty well. I sense there are fewer good days, more better days and actually fewer best days, since they're not as productive in a linear sense. They are fun though. :)
